The Advantages of Choosing an Exterior Door with a Window
When it comes to picking the ideal exterior door for a home, many homeowner neglect a crucial element: the addition of a window. Exterior doors with windows not only offer aesthetic appeal but likewise improve functionality and natural light in a home. This short article will explore the various advantages of picking an exterior door with a window, the types readily available, and some vital considerations for homeowners.
Benefits of Exterior Doors with Windows1. Increased Natural Light
Among the main advantages of setting up an exterior door with a window is the increase of natural light it offers. This light can cheer up entranceways, corridors, and adjacent areas, producing a warm and welcoming environment. The advantages of natural light include:

When picking an exterior door with windows, homeowners usually encounter numerous types. Understanding these choices is vital for making a knowledgeable decision.
1. Fiberglass Doors
Fiberglass doors are a popular choice due to their low maintenance requirements and high energy effectiveness. They can also be created to simulate wood grain, offering the visual appeal of wood without its downsides.
2. Steel Doors
Steel doors are understood for their resilience and strength. Numerous makers offer steel doors with ornamental glass panels, allowing house owners to delight in both security and design.
3. Wood Doors
Wood doors stay a classic option, exhibiting elegance and charm. They can be customized to fit any design and can include different window styles, such as sidelights or transoms.
4. Patio area Doors
Sliding or French outdoor patio doors frequently feature big panes of glass, enabling maximum light and a seamless transition to outdoor home. While they mainly work as access indicate patio areas, their style can enhance the overall Exterior Door With Window of the home.
5. Storm Doors
Setting up a storm door with a window can supply insulation and protect the main door from weather aspects. Many storm doors include interchangeable glass and screen panels, using flexibility for various seasons.

Are exterior doors with windows energy-efficient?
Yes, numerous modern exterior doors with windows come with energy-efficient glass choices and insulation, which can help in reducing energy expenses.
2. Do exterior doors with windows provide security?
While windows can position a security threat, many exterior doors are created with strengthened glass and durable locking mechanisms to enhance security.
3. How do I pick the best design for my home?
Consider the architectural style of your home and complement it with a door that matches or improves that visual. Checking out regional design trends can likewise offer insight.
4. How much do exterior doors with windows cost?
The cost can differ widely based upon the product, design, and extra functions. Usually, property owners can expect to pay between ₤ 500 and ₤ 3,000 for an exterior door with a window.
5. Can I set up an exterior door with a window myself?
While it is possible for a useful homeowner to set up a door themselves, it is recommended to employ an expert for finest results, particularly for ensuring appropriate energy performance and security.
